sql >> Databáze >  >> RDS >> Mysql

Které řazení MySQL porovnává např. é a e jako stejné?

Protože jste řekli, že používáte sadu znaků utf8, odpověď na vaši původní otázku je „všechny kromě utf8_bin“.

Ve všech těchto porovnáváních zjistíte, že 'e' ='ê'.

Nevím však o žádném řazení, kde by 'æ' ='ae' nebo 'ø' ='o'.

 utf8_czech_ci
 utf8_danish_ci
 utf8_esperanto_ci
 utf8_estonian_ci
 utf8_general_ci
 utf8_hungarian_ci
 utf8_icelandic_ci
 utf8_latvian_ci
 utf8_lithuanian_ci
 utf8_persian_ci
 utf8_polish_ci
 utf8_roman_ci
 utf8_romanian_ci
 utf8_sinhala_ci
 utf8_slovak_ci
 utf8_slovenian_ci
 utf8_spanish_ci
 utf8_spanish2_ci
 utf8_swedish_ci
 utf8_turkish_ci
 utf8_unicode_ci


  1. Zachycení hodnot prvků HTML v dynamické tabulce

  2. Příkaz SQL CASE:Co to je a jaké jsou nejlepší způsoby jeho použití?

  3. Seskupení podle data, návratový řádek, i když nebyly nalezeny žádné záznamy

  4. Předat hodnoty načtené ze souboru jako vstup do SQL dotazu v Oracle